Fox Sports North will televise eight Lynx games this summer, in addition to the two games that will be shown on ESPN 2.

 FSN will air the season opener, June 1, against Connecticut. Other highlights include the June 23 game against Tulsa (featuring Skylar Diggins); the July 7 game with Phoenix and top draft pick Brittney Griner and the September 4 game with Los Angeles, a rematch of last season's Western Conference finals. 

The Lynx will also be on ESPN 2 twice, July 9 vs. Atlanta and Aug. 24 vs. Indiana.
